The Echo FIVE workshop prepares E5's with a foundation to be a Leading Petty Officer (LPO) with a place to start.
This four day workshop focuses on John Maxwell’s sixth law of leadership, The Law of Solid Ground (21 Irrefutable Laws of Leadership). This law states "that leadership is built on a foundation of trust. If a leader doesn’t have their followers’ trust, or they’ve broken it, they can’t exert influence over those people." All active duty, reserve, and guard E5's are welcome to attend. The facilitators are volunteer E6's who are graduates of our Foundry leadership course. They provide the framework and know-how on things like sponsorship, recognition, draft the initial evaluation input, time management, holding quarters, leading division physical fitness, to list a few topics. Who better to teach competence, connection, and character in order to provide guidance on a position than those successfully doing the job?
